More Hanford public tours added due to high demand

Public tours of the Hanford environmental cleanup work include a stop at the Environmental Restoration Disposal Facility in central Hanford.
Public tours of the Hanford environmental cleanup work include a stop at the Environmental Restoration Disposal Facility in central Hanford. Courtesy DOE

More tours of Hanford environmental cleanup projects have been added for 2016, after most seats on the originally scheduled tours were claimed by noon Tuesday.

Registration for the first 15 tours opened at 9 a.m.

The Department of Energy will open registration for 10 more bus tours on June 1 at www.hanford.gov. Participants must be U.S. citizens and at least 18 years old.

New dates for the four-hour tours are Aug. 2, 3, 10, 16, 17, 24, 30 and 31 and Sept. 7 and 8.

People also may check back occasionally at www.hanford.gov so see if any seats have become available due to cancellations.

The tours are offered by the Department of Energy and are unrelated to the tours of B Reactor and other historic tours of Hanford offered by the National Park Service with DOEfor visitors to the new Manhattan Project National Park at Hanford.

Sign up for B Reactor tours or tours covering the pre-World War II history of Hanford at 509-376-1647.
